COVID-19: Auckland managed isolation worker visited kindergarten before testing positive – Newshub
The cleaner tested positive for the virus on Monday due to routine surveillance testing.

A cleaner at a managed isolation facility in Auckland visited a kindergarten three days before they tested positive for COVID-19.
The case, who works at Auckland’s Grand Millennium Hotel, visited BestStart St Lukes to collect a grandchild on Friday. They later tested positive for the virus on Monday due to routine surveillance testing.
In a statement to Newshub on Wednesday, a spokesperson for Auckland Regional Public Health Service (ARPHS) confirmed it has been working with BestStart St Lukes…
